new tea towel design ... retro spice canisters



I have been toying with the idea of a canisters tea towel for more than a year now ... but it wasn't until I scored these lovely, bright, vintage spice canisters at Camberwell Market a few months ago, that I knew what I wanted to do.


Two things struck me about these canisters - the colours and the font used. The colours are old school and just really work well together, and the font is just so retro it was hard to resist. Can you guess what each of the spices are? I don't know for sure, but I have a pretty good idea ... let me know what you think!

The challenge of a five colour print was a little daunting at first, but I am just thrilled with both the results and the fact that I could actually do it. These tea towels take a while to print, but watching the colourful image build is very exciting.
